Instrument selection
DRL-3 (enhanced type) is an increase in hot electrode temperature based on DRL-3 (standard type), mainly used for testing materials with slightly higher testing temperature requirements and lower thermal conductivity; DRL-3A is mainly used for testing materials with slightly higher temperature requirements; DRL-3B is mainly used for measuring insulation materials.
